Wenn das so ist, dann musst du es entweder so machen wie du ganz oben geschriebn hast, oder das Record umstrukturieren:
Von:
Delphi-Quellcode:
Verwaltungsdatei_Header = packed record
aDatentraeger_Nummer: string[3]; // 1
xFuellzeichen1: string[3]; // 4
aBeraternummer: string[7]; // 7
aBeratername: string[9]; // 14
xRestart_Kennzeichen: Char; // 23
nAnzahl_Datendateien: string[5]; // 24
nLetzte_Datendateinummer: string[5]; // 29
xFuellzeichen2: string[95]; // 34
end;
nach:
Delphi-Quellcode:
Verwaltungsdatei_Header = packed record
aDatentraeger_Nummer: array[0..2] of char; // oder: array[1..3] of char // 1
...
Dann gehts auch wieder mit einem Rutsch
T. Dieffenbach
"Delphi"-Version: Lazarus 0.9.22
Was ist der Unterschied zwischen Bill Gates und Gott?
-->Gott hält sich nicht für Bill Gates!